Known as one of the UK’s greenest cities, Sheffield is an ideal blend of urban living and natural beauty. It’s home to a lively cultural scene, with attractions like the Millennium Gallery and the Sheffield Theatres complex, which has four theatres to choose from, as well as historical sites like the Kelham Island Museum. Plus, with the Peak District so close by and plenty of parks in the city, you’ll have tons of options for an escape into the English countryside – whether you’re taking on Mam Tor in the Peaks, lounging in Weston Park, or watching the sunset from the top of The Bole Hills.
Top three things to do in Sheffield
1. Visit the Millennium Gallery
At Sheffield’s Millennium Gallery, you’ll see a snapshot of the Steel City’s deep-rooted history. Examples of metalwork that made this city famous are on display, as well as the Ruskin Collection. This line-up, established in the 1800s, features art, illustrated manuscripts, and minerals. Plus, the gallery hosts temporary exhibitions, bringing national and international art to Sheffield.
2. Go for a stroll or hike in the city’s outdoor spaces
With about a third of Sheffield located in the Peak District, there are endless hiking, climbing and biking spots in this national park within a stone’s throw of the city centre. The city itself offers plenty of green spaces, too. The Botanical Gardens are home to over 5,000 plant species, or you can head into the Winter Garden, Europe’s largest urban greenhouse – perfect for a stroll on those chillier days.
3. Catch a show at one of Sheffield’s iconic theatres
Sheffield is known for its theatre scene, home to the largest theatre complex outside of London – you’ll find the Crucible, Lyceum, and Playhouse all in the city centre, as well as other smaller theatres and performance spaces. These theatres have something for everyone, from classic plays to contemporary works.
